The Birth of the Casino: A Historical Perspective

The concept of gambling can be traced back to ancient civilizations, but the modern casino as we know it began to take shape in the 17th century. The first official casino, the Ridotto, opened its doors in Venice in 1638, initially designed to provide entertainment for the elite. As gambling became more popular, casinos began to emerge in various parts of Europe, each with its own set of rules and games.

The Infamous Card Shark: The Legend of Edward O. Thorp

One figure who epitomizes the legendary status of gamblers is Edward O. Thorp. Known as the father of card counting, Thorp revolutionized the game of blackjack by applying mathematical strategies to beat the house. His success at casinos across the United States led to a significant shift in how players approached the game. Today, his legacy continues, as many still seek to replicate his success.

The Legendary Rat Pack: The Kings of the Casino

In the 1960s, the Rat Pack, consisting of Frank Sinatra, Dean Martin, and Sammy Davis Jr., became synonymous with the Las Vegas casino scene. Their performances not only drew large crowds but also significantly influenced the culture of gambling. The glitz and glamour they brought to the stage helped solidify Las Vegas as the entertainment capital of the world, establishing a legacy that endures to this day.
